comparemela.com
Home
Amherst Town Swimming Pools
Top Locations Tagged with Amherst Town Swimming Pools
Amherst Town Swimming Pools in United States - 24521/City near Amherst
1). Amherst Town Sewer Plant, Industrial Dr
vimarsana © 2020. All Rights Reserved.